What Is a Sex Crime?
Acts committed by an individual involving coerced or illegal sexual behaviors are called sex crimes or sexual offenses. These crimes can include non-consensual sexual misconduct and sexual exploitation. Sex crimes are considered serious offenses due to the impacts on their victims and the potential for long-lasting physical, emotional, and psychological harm. Examples of sex crimes include:
- Sexual assault
- Child sexual abuse
- Sexual harassment
- Sexual exploitation
- Indecent exposure
- Internet sex crimes
How Can a Sex Crime Lawyer Help Me?
An experienced lawyer can give you the knowledge and backing you need to navigate the legal system, finding the best possible results for your case. Because laws are different from state to state, speaking with a lawyer near you is critical in understanding all the elements of your situation and making the best decisions to move forward. A sex crime lawyer can help with:
- Legal counsel and guidance
- Investigating and gathering evidence
- Defense strategy development
- Negotiating and plea bargaining
- Court representation
What Are the Top Questions When Choosing a Sex Crime Lawyer?
These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case well. Many lawyers offer free consultations that allow you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. Top questions include:
- What experience do you have in handling sex crime cases?
- What is your approach to defending clients accused of sex crimes?
- What potential legal strategies may be applicable to my case?
- What are the potential consequences and penalties I may face if convicted?
- How will you communicate with me through this legal process?
